Ecuadorian Soldiers Killed in Illegal Mining Ambush

Eleven Ecuadorian soldiers died and one was wounded in an ambush by the Comandos de la Frontera group during an anti-illegal mining operation in Orellana province on Friday; one attacker also died.

US-UK Trade Deal Celebrated Amidst Economists' Concerns

US President Trump and UK Prime Minister Starmer announced a trade deal on May 8th, but economists express concern over the deal's limited scope as many British goods still face a 10% tariff, temporarily suspended for 90 days, potentially creating further trade tensions with the EU.
